Chennai GMPians' meet XLRI GMP 2009-2010 batch

Last Sunday (16-May-2010), future GMPians from Chennai got an opportunity to talk to a few people from the GMP 2009-2010 batch.

It was the first meet with the Alumni for the Chennai GMPians.

Seniors were of all praise for this program. Every one of them is satisfied with the program and its prospects.

Some interesting facts:

  1. XLRI Dean has announced that XLRI GMP will be the flagship program of XLRI !! Now there is only one dean for BM, PMIR and GMP programs.
  2. Faculty is one among the best in India & Asia Pacific - not only for HR, but also for other disciplines.
  3. The program will be rigorous. Just to give a feel of the program, classes will be from 9AM to 9 PM during the induction program (held for 3 days starting June 12)!!
  4. Students will be very dynamic and participate in various events in spite of the tight program schedule.
  5. There will be international immersion program, where students will go to various abroad universities in groups. They will get opportunity to listen to lectures along with having a first-hand experience of the working in the industry at the respective countries.
  6. People from diverse backgrounds and experience participate in this program. So, students learn quite a lot from the peers in addition to what they learn from faculty.
  7. Adventure tour and Village trip programs will be very good and they will create good bonding among the students at the same time exposing students to realities & hardships of life.
